OELWEIN, Iowa — Firefighters in Oelwein are investigating the cause of a fire that damaged a building on Second Avenue Southeast.
Officials reported that a passerby alerted them to the fire around 8:30 p.m.
Fire crews from Hazleton and Fairbank, along with MercyOne Ambulance, assisted at the scene.
There were no injuries, and the building was unoccupied at the time.
The damage is estimated to be more than $150,000.
Investigators continue to assess the scene.
